site stats

Proguard shrinking

WebJan 21, 2024 · Proguard is a tool which shrinks, optimizes, and obfuscates code. It detects and removes unused classes, fields, methods and attributes from APK. It optimizes bytecode and removes unused... WebJan 18, 2024 · Code shrinking is an approach that allows us to generate smaller APKs by removing unused code or refactoring existing code, resulting in a smaller footprint. In …

android studio小游戏源代码 - CSDN文库

WebOct 24, 2024 · 一目了然,当您使用 Android Gradle插件3.4.0 或更高版本,该插件不再使用Proguard执行编译时代码优化.相反,该插件默认情况下与R8编译器一起使用,以处理收缩,混淆并优化您的应用程序.但是,您可以通过Proguard规则文件禁用某些任务或自定义R8的行为. 实际上,R8 ... WebProGuard Warranty Has Different Protections Plans You Can Choose From To Help Keep Your Life Moving! We Even Have 24/7 Roadside Assistance. Skip to main content. DEALER … champion mayors for inclusive growth https://rodrigo-brito.com

android - Proguard: How to avoid shrinking (and …

http://www.dre.vanderbilt.edu/~schmidt/android/android-4.0/external/proguard/docs/manual/gui.html WebWhat is shrinking?¶ Java source code (.java files) is typically compiled to bytecode (.class files). Bytecode is more compact than Java source code, but it may still contain a lot of unused code, especially if it includes program libraries. Shrinking programs such as ProGuard can analyze bytecode and remove unused classes, fields, and methods ... WebFeb 27, 2012 · In older versions, the way you would enable ProGuard shrinking and obfuscation was to define proguard.config=. As of ADT 17, the proguard.config property refers to a path instead, so you can specify as many configuration files as you want. These are all joined together by ProGuard. happy valley goose bay flea market

How To Obfuscate In Android With ProGuard - Medium

Category:Analyze your build with the APK Analyzer Android Developers

Tags:Proguard shrinking

Proguard shrinking

Android Tutorial => ProGuard - Obfuscating and Shrinking your code

WebProGuard allows the developer to obfuscate, shrink and optimize his code. #1 The first step of the procedure is to enable proguard on the build. This can be done by setting the 'minifyEnabled' command to true on your desired build #2 The second step is to specify which proguard files are we using for the given build WebNov 24, 2024 · Dec 4, 2024, 4:44 AM The answer is in the error message: Please set the code shrinker to r8 When using the d8 dex compiler you need to use the r8 linker. This is the …

Proguard shrinking

Did you know?

WebProGuard allows the developer to obfuscate, shrink and optimize his code. #1 The first step of the procedure is to enable proguard on the build. This can be done by setting the … WebProGuard allows the developer to obfuscate, shrink and optimize his code. #1 The first step of the procedure is to enable proguard on the build. This can be done by setting the 'minifyEnabled' command to true on your desired build #2 The second step is to specify which proguard files are we using for the given build

WebOct 8, 2024 · Most of the time, you need to customize proguard rules, let’s say if you are using a 3rd party library. You should consider checking your 3rd party lib’s documentation regarding obfuscation ... WebDec 8, 2024 · There are two main tools for enabling code shrinking in your project. ProGuard and DexGuard: ProGuard is a free tool that’s included in Android Studio. DexGuard is the commercial version of ProGuard which offers more advanced shrinking and obfuscation.

WebDec 21, 2024 · Load ProGuard mappings. Next to the filtering icons are the ProGuard mapping icons. ... For example, ProGuard shrinking rules can alter your final code, and image resources can be overridden by resources in a product flavor. To view the final version of your files with the APK Analyzer, click the entity for a preview of the text or image entity ... WebFeb 23, 2024 · Proguard is a java tool that is present in Android and it is used to reduce your app size. It is a free tool that will help you to reduce your app size by 8.5 %. Proguard will …

WebJul 3, 2024 · For those who are new to ProGaurd, ProGuard is an open-sourced Java class file shrinker, optimizer, obfuscator, and preverifier. ... Pauses code-shrinking. By default, ProGuard/R8 shrinks the code ...

WebThe Information tab presents a number of options for preverification and targeting, and for the information that ProGuard returns when processing your code. The bottom list allows you to query ProGuard about why given classes and class members are being kept in the shrinking step. Corresponding configuration options: - dontpreverify - microedition happy valley goodness coWebMay 11, 2024 · ProGuard Building offers a superior range of roof coating solutions with outstanding endurance and dependability. Pouring rain, ponding water or packed snow is … champion meaning in the bibleWebMar 15, 2024 · 1. Proguard JAVA 8 Proguard will start shrinking the source code while we trigger a build in release mode from the android studio, First, it will compile all java code into the .class file... champion megaphone sportsWebTo allow ProGuard to continue to optimize, obfuscate and shrink Kotlin generated class files and their corresponding metadata ProGuard now supports Kotlin reading Kotlin classes from version 1.0 to 1.7 and writing Kotlin metadata with version 1.6 (readable by Kotlin reflection library / compiler 1.5 - 1.7). Add support for Kotlin 1.7. happy valley goose bay abbreviationWeb我需要一些幫助,我已經激活了代碼混淆的 proguard,但是當我啟動應用程序時,崩潰和 logcat 打印這個: 在 proguard 文件中,我添加了這一行,但沒有任何改變。 adsbygoogle window.adsbygoogle .push 嘗試在用戶中添加 keep 和 keepnam ... [ … happy valley ghost townhttp://duoduokou.com/java/50876248296291590353.html champion memory foam insoleWebApr 14, 2024 · 1、Proguard 介绍. ProGuard 是一个压缩、优化和混淆 Java 字节码文件的免费的工具,它可以删除无用的类、字段、方法和属性。可以删除没用的注释,最大限度地优化字节码文件。它还可以使用简短的无意义的名称来重命名已经存在的类、字段、方法和属性。 happy valley goose bay time zone